mso-bidi-font-size:12.0pt\"\u003eInnumerable references to the foot and to foot worship in Indian culture convey the impression that the foot is regarded as an important part of the human body. The foot is usually the part of the body that is venerated; the feet of elders are worshipped by the younger generation the feet of idols by their devotees; the feet of innocent persons by wrongdoers seeking forgiveness. There is also the romantic attachment towards the beloved’s foot. It was in this context that Indian miniature painting, drama and poetry referred to men treasuring the touch of the foot of their beloved. My parents first travelled to India from Switzerland in 1936, when I was a young child. As was the custom at that time, they went by ship to Bombay and visited various pans of India by chartered railway carriage. The photographs and stories they brought back made a deep impression on me and I dreamed of visiting the wonderful, colourful places they depicted and of learning about the ancient, rich and mysterious cultures of India.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003eLittle did I realise that later in life I would have many opportunities to visit the region, not as a student or tourist, but on business. In 1946, I married Thomas Bata, whose family had expanded their international footwear enterprise to the Indian subcontinent already before the Second World War. Since I have always taken an active interest in the business, I have been a frequent visitor.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003eDuring our early travels, most people, particularly in the South, went barefoot. Our challenge was to make and sell quality footwear at an affordable price. In an effort to gain an insight into the different customs and traditions of the diverse markets, we visited many parts of India, including not only large cities, but also a great number of small communities.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003eWe discovered that to fully understand the business environment, we also had to study the cultural history. I am particularly grateful to John Vollmer of Vollmer Cultural Partnerships Inc., who acted as our project co-ordinator, and also Julia Pine, our acting curator, for their tremendous assistance and tireless work, which were essential to the success of this endeavour.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003eThrough the study of the role of feet and footwear in the past and present, we hope to contribute in our specific field to the knowledge of the traditions and customs of this rich and complex subcontinent, which has been the home of a fifth of all humanity.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:8.0p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p align=\"center\" class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:center\"\u003e \u003cb style=\"mso-bidi-font- weight: normal\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font- size:9.5pt\"\u003eIntroduction\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/b\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eThere are innumerable references to feet and feet worship in Indian literature. The religious and cultural significance of feet in the Indian tradition is unique. The \u003cspan class=\"GramE\"\u003efeet are considered to be sacred and therefore objects\u003c\/span\u003e of veneration: the feet of elders are worshipped by the younger generation, the feet of religious teachers and holy men and women by their followers, the feet of idols by their devotees, and the feet of those from whom a wrongdoer seeks forgiveness.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eAlmost paradoxically, the sentiment of humility and sub-\u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003emissiveness\u003c\/span\u003e evoking the emotions of awe, respect, and adoration are rooted in the idea that feet are the humblest, most impure, and polluting part of the body, and therefore may command respect by those who surrender their ego to the venerable. The \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003e\u003cspan class=\"GramE\"\u003ebrahminic\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e belief that the steps and shadow of an outcaste should be avoided as they bring bad luck, is also rooted in the same notion of humbleness of feet. Connected too with this sense of surrender and humility, is the romantic sentiment associated with the beloved's feet as glorified in literature. The lover admires them by caressing them as a demonstration of his ultimate devotion to her and vice versa. It was in this context that Indian painting, drama, and poetry referred to men treasuring the touch of the foot of their beloved, and women lavishing great cosmetic attention to their feet and adorning them with as much care as they would take to beautify their face. The tender foot then becomes the symbol of affection and sensual desire, and plays an effective role in love-play. Radha sitting at the god Krishna's feet; Krishna gently massaging \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003eRadha's\u003c\/span\u003e feet; or the delightful story of the callow Brahmin who, when his head was touched by the foot of a courtesan in love-play, seeks to receive exoneration from this \"pollution\", and ends up as the butt of ridicule, are examples of the unique significance that feet enjoy in the Indian amorous imagination. These as well as the romantic and erotic symbolic connotations of painting or tattooing the feet, using toe-rings, anklets, and other forms of foot adornment and the associated love poetry; the sounds of footfalls; the soft thud of bare feet; silent steps in the dark of night; the tapping sound of wooden sandals; the jingling of ankle bells; the rhythm of dance; the magical power of the foot of the goddess; and the religious significance of footprints are the themes elaborated in this book. Part \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:10.5pt;mso-bidi- font-weight: bold\"\u003eIII \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font- size:9.5pt\"\u003eelaborates the contemporary customs of shoemaking in India.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eIt was a common practice in most of rural India, until half a century ago, to walk barefoot, and therefore it would not be an exaggeration to generally describe India as a \"barefoot country\". However, shoes were worn for protection of feet against severe climatic or topographic conditions in certain northern mountainous regions of the country. \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:10.5pt;mso-bidi-font-weight:bold\"\u003eIn \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eall likelihood, the Indian aristocracy may have developed already a taste for footwear in the early centuries of the Christian era, as is evident from the sculpture of the period. The possibility of origin of several styles and genres of footwear having been rooted in the fusion of indigenous traditions and \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003eGraeco\u003c\/span\u003e Roman and \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003eKushana\u003c\/span\u003e influences of the time cannot be overlooked. Apparently, under Mughal influence, the use of a variety of footwear, especially among the upper classes, became a norm. The ascetics of the Hindu, Buddhist and \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003eJaina\u003c\/span\u003e sects were not generally permitted the worldly luxury of footwear, but to prevent contact with any ritually impure substances they were allowed to use footwear made from wood or other such \"purer\" materials. Footwear of divine personages was the vehicle of the dust of their holy feet and as such was considered to be worthy of veneration. This idea led to the practice of worshipping holy men and divinities not in the form of their anthropomorphic image but by their symbolic representation in the form of their footwear.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eNonetheless, over the course of centuries, a rich variety of footwear was created in India, and this included sandals, \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003ebabouches\u003c\/span\u003e, mules, slippers, shoes, boots, socks and stockings. These were made from a number of raw materials such as cow, buffalo or goat hide, silk, wool or cotton fibre and, various grasses. The very typical Indian toe-knob sandals, known as \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:10.5pt;mso-bidi-font- style:italic\"\u003epaduka\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:10.5pt;mso-bidi-font-style:italic\"\u003e, \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003ewere made of such materials as wood, ivory, brass, silver, semi-precious stone such as jade, or a combination of these. Shoes were embellished with a great sense of aesthetics and designed in a number of ways including embroidery, \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003eapplique\u003c\/span\u003e work, inlay of precious stones, silver or gold brocade, and \u003cspan class=\"SpellE\"\u003etasselling\u003c\/span\u003e. The reason for this abundance and variety may lie in the enormous diversity of climatic conditions, ethnic and cultural traditions, ritual conventions, and exposure to the outside world through voyages and trade. These factors, perhaps in combination, catalyzed the development of the plethora of types and variations of footwear that were and are to be found all over India.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eAs we have noted earlier, shoes were not worn daily, but only on particular occasions. Indeed, a major part of India enjoys a warm climate for most of the year and therefore there is hardly an absolute necessity to wear shoes to protect the feet against extreme climatic conditions such as ice and snow as is the case in many other parts of the world. The utilitarian and functional aspect of the shoe and footwear is thus, to a degree, replaced in the Indian context by a religious, ritual, symbolic, ceremonial, or allegorical value.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003e\u003cp\u003e \u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t; mso-bidi-font-size:9.5pt\"\u003eOnly in some regions of India, such as the hilly northern and north-eastern regions, are produced, to this day, a variety of shoes, boots, and socks made of leather, wool, or vegetable fibre or mixed materials, that are delightfully patterned and, besides being decorative, protect the feet against the extreme climatic conditions there. The north-eastern regions of the upper Himalayan mountains are renowned for their innovative manufacture of footwear made of grasses or reeds, sometimes in combination with felt, wool, or jute, which are ideally suited for to the damp climate and serve as protection against the biting cold of the high mountain regions.\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p class=\"Style\" style=\"text-align:justify\"\u003e \u003cspan style=\"font-size:13.0pt;
